Coniferous Forest
Forested area generally found in areas with temperate climate and characterized by cone-bearing trees that are mostly evergreens with needle-shaped or scalelike leaves.
Spruce
A type of evergreen coniferous tree belonging to the genus Picea, known for its needle-like leaves and conical shape.
Savannah
A mixed landscape of grasslands and scattered trees, often found in tropical to subtropical regions, supporting a diverse array of flora and fauna.
Grasslands
Ecosystems dominated by grasses, often found in regions where there is not enough regular rainfall to support the growth of a forest, but more than that to form a desert.
